第一步获得human proposal第二步是将proposal输入到两个并行的分支里面,上面的分支是STN+SPPE+SDTN的结构,STN接收的是human proposal,SDTN产生的是pose proposal。下面并行的分支充当额外的正则化矫正器。第三步是对pose proposal做Pose NMS(非最大值抑制),用来消除冗余的pose proposal。

Human pose is typically represented by a coordinate vector of body joints or their heatmap embeddings. While easy for data processing, unrealistic pose estimates are admitted due to the lack of dependency modeling between the body joints. In this paper, we present a structured representation, ...
